Property Details for 17 Mawson Tce, Moss Vale

17 Mawson Tce, Moss Vale is a 5 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1994. The property has a land size of 1002m2 and floor size of 176m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in January 2026. About Moss Vale 2577

The size of Moss Vale is approximately 79.5 square kilometres. It has 28 parks covering nearly 2.9% of total area. The population of Moss Vale in 2016 was 8579 people. By 2021 the population was 9310 showing a population growth of 8.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Moss Vale is 60-69 years. Households in Moss Vale are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Moss Vale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.00% of the homes in Moss Vale were owner-occupied compared with 68.20% in 2016.

Moss Vale has 5,450 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Moss Vale have seen a 40.62%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 41.12% increase. As at 31 December 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Moss Vale is $1,043,917 while the median value for Units is $775,532.
  • Houses have a median rent of $700 while Units have a median rent of $600.
